Minnesota Man Shot In Head At Funeral Suspect In Custody

The shooting happened at 10 a.m. local time in the Head Start building and community center in the Fond Du Lac High School on the Fond du Lac Band Reservation, and a rifle believed to have been used in the shooting was recovered at the scene by police. There is a suspect in custody, identified as Shelby Gene Boswell, 28, at a press conference held by Derek Randall, the interim police chief in Cloquet, the town that most closely borders the Fond du Lac reservation....

Mirabelli Hints At Imminent Ac Milan Contract Renewal For Gattuso

Gattuso was appointed in November 2017 as a replacement for Vincenzo Montella, but he only signed a contract to the end of the season. Milan have improved under the leadership of the former Italy midfielder, although a Europa League exit to Arsenal was a setback for the Rossoneri. Gattuso, however, appears to have done enough to earn the chance to take Milan into next season, with his side unbeaten in 10 Serie A matches, winning their last five games in the league....

Mirallas Returns To Olympiacos On Loan From Everton

Mirallas will join the Greek outfit until the end of the 2017-18 season and he will hope to help them push for the Super League title. The Belgium international has been limited to just five Premier League appearances this season, starting only two, and has not featured since November. Mirallas is contracted to Everton until 2020, having signed a three-year deal last May, but leaves this month temporarily to return to his former side, who announced the deal on Twitter on Saturday....

Mj Hegar Wins Primary To Oust John Cornyn Next Stop Turn Texas Blue

Hegar won the Democratic nomination in the Lone Star State’s runoff election Tuesday with a narrow victory over Royce West. If Hegar is successful in November, her election will mark the first time a liberal has represented the state in Congress since 1994. Hegar first arrived on the scene in 2018 when she narrowly lost her congressional bid against Republican Representative John Carter. Before wading into politics, she was a pilot in the Air Force and was awarded a Purple Heart after she was wounded on her third tour to Afghanistan....

Mlb Can Position Itself To Ensure A Minor Victory On Meager Salaries

The Washington Post reported Sunday that MLB and Minor League Baseball are lobbying Congress to help MLB organizations avoid paying higher salaries to minor-leaguers through a proposed provision in the federal spending bill that is going before lawmakers this week. According to the Post, the lobbying is part of an effort to make moot a lawsuit against MLB that, among other things, seeks higher wages for players. Baseball is lobbying Congress to exempt it from federal labor laws and include the exemption in the spending plan....
